Output 51c335bb3c4af01dd55c33d0f051b6f4dba197473c27421eaa5f26d792e54aaf:1

value
1089435
script pubkey
OP_0 OP_PUSHBYTES_20 fcfa221ee542dc621dbb4bddca731eed72d4195c
address
bc1qlnazy8h9gtwxy8dmf0wu5uc7a4edgx2urwjhcx
transaction
51c335bb3c4af01dd55c33d0f051b6f4dba197473c27421eaa5f26d792e54aaf
confirmations
223541
spent
true